Samsung Bangladesh to introduce free sterilizing facility for electronic gadgets

More and more public awareness is growing with each day to contain the spread of COVID-19. To restrain coronavirus from continuing the death tolls, organizations and brands across the world have been striving with their technologies and innovations.

In this process, leading electronic device manufacturer Samsung has set another signature of excellence in Bangladesh by introducing ‘free UV sterilization’ facility – recently the company has introduced the sterilization solution for its customers.

The service is completely free of charge and can be availed by all upon arriving at the customer care centers. The sterilization process takes place inside a compact, rectangular box that is operated through wireless technology.

The device called ‘ITFIT UV Sterilizer’ uses UV rays to destroy up to 99 percent bacteria within 10 minutes. Multiple UV lamps placed in alternate sides of the box ensure complete coverage for sterilizing mobiles, spectacles, earphones, wristwatches, and most other small gadgets that can be exposed to contamination. Samsung is offering instant disinfection for such devices, which is hassle-free and reliable.
